Martin Marietta confirms acquisition from Blue Water Industries

Martin Marietta is an American aggregate producer. Image: Victoria//stock.adobe.com Martin Marietta has confirmed it has completed its acquisition of aggregate operations from Blue Water Industries.   Martin Marietta has acquired 20 active aggregate operations in Alabama, South Carolina, South Florida, Tennessee, and Virginia for $2.05 billion in cash.   “The BWI Southeast acquisition naturally complements …
